Fire Breaks Out Inside Lexington Commercial Building

Lexington firefighters received an early wakeup call for a blaze inside a commercial building Wednesday morning.

But by the time crews arrived at the scene, the building's sprinkler system had already done its job, knocking the fire out.

Firefighters got the call just before 2 a.m. for an alarm at building along Prim Rose Court. Crews cut through an overhead door to get onto the facility, used by iHigh.com for storage.

The sprinklers did what they're supposed to do. They held the fire in check, they notified us when they were activated and now we'll get to clean it up," Lexington Fire Dept. Batt. Chief Harold Hoskins said.

There were no reported injuries.

No word on what sparked the blaze.
